The Delos A. Blodgett House (also known as 8VO4385) is a historic house located at 404 Ridgewood Avenue in Daytona Beach, Florida.

Description and history

The 2-1/2 story house was completed in 1896 for Delos A. Blodgett and his wife Daisy A. Peck.[1] It was listed on the National Register of Historic Places on August 2, 1993.[1]

Design

The Delos A. Blodgett House was designed by architect, Sumner Hale Gove in the Queen Anne style.[2]
